#202060 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#202060 is composed of 12.5% red, 12.5% green and 37.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 66.7% cyan, 66.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 62.4% black. It has a hue angle of 240 degrees, a saturation of 50% and a lightness of 25.1%. #202060 color hex could be obtained by blending #4040c0 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

#202060 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#202060 has RGB values of R:32, G:32, B:96 and CMYK values of C:0.67, M:0.67, Y:0, K:0.62. Its decimal value is 2105440.
